25 /** @file parallel/partial_sum.h
26  *  @brief Parallel implementation of std::partial_sum(), i. e. prefix
27  *  sums.
28  *  This file is a GNU parallel extension to the Standard C++ Library.
29  */
30
31 // Written by Johannes Singler.
32
33 #ifndef _GLIBCXX_PARALLEL_PARTIAL_SUM_H
34 #define _GLIBCXX_PARALLEL_PARTIAL_SUM_H 1
35
36 #include <omp.h>
37 #include <new>
38 #include <bits/stl_algobase.h>
39 #include <parallel/parallel.h>
40 #include <parallel/numericfwd.h>
41
42 namespace __gnu_parallel
43 {
44   // Problem: there is no 0-element given.
45
46 /** @brief Base case prefix sum routine.
47   *  @param begin Begin iterator of input sequence.
48   *  @param end End iterator of input sequence.
49   *  @param result Begin iterator of output sequence.
50   *  @param bin_op Associative binary function.
51   *  @param value Start value. Must be passed since the neutral
52   *  element is unknown in general.
53   *  @return End iterator of output sequence. */
54 template<typename InputIterator,
55          typename OutputIterator,
56          typename BinaryOperation>
57   OutputIterator
58   parallel_partial_sum_basecase(InputIterator begin, InputIterator end,
59                                 OutputIterator result, BinaryOperation bin_op,
60                                 typename std::iterator_traits
61                                 <InputIterator>::value_type value)
62   {
63     if (begin == end)
64       return result;
65
66     while (begin != end)
67       {
68         value = bin_op(value, *begin);
69         *result = value;
70         ++result;
71         ++begin;
72       }
73     return result;
74   }
75
76 /** @brief Parallel partial sum implementation, two-phase approach,
77     no recursion.
78     *  @param begin Begin iterator of input sequence.
79     *  @param end End iterator of input sequence.
80     *  @param result Begin iterator of output sequence.
81     *  @param bin_op Associative binary function.
82     *  @param n Length of sequence.
83     *  @param num_threads Number of threads to use.
84     *  @return End iterator of output sequence.
85     */
86 template<typename InputIterator,
87          typename OutputIterator,
88          typename BinaryOperation>
89   OutputIterator
90   parallel_partial_sum_linear(InputIterator begin, InputIterator end,
91                               OutputIterator result, BinaryOperation bin_op,
92                               typename std::iterator_traits
93                               <InputIterator>::difference_type n)
94   {
95     typedef std::iterator_traits<InputIterator> traits_type;
96     typedef typename traits_type::value_type value_type;
97     typedef typename traits_type::difference_type difference_type;
98
99     if (begin == end)
100       return result;
101
102     thread_index_t num_threads =
103         std::min<difference_type>(get_max_threads(), n - 1);
104
105     if (num_threads < 2)
106       {
107         *result = *begin;
108         return parallel_partial_sum_basecase(
109             begin + 1, end, result + 1, bin_op, *begin);
110       }
111
112     difference_type* borders;
113     value_type* sums;
114
115     const _Settings& __s = _Settings::get();
116
117 #   pragma omp parallel num_threads(num_threads)
118       {
119 #       pragma omp single
120           {
121             num_threads = omp_get_num_threads();
122
123             borders = new difference_type[num_threads + 2];
124
125             if (__s.partial_sum_dilation == 1.0f)
126               equally_split(n, num_threads + 1, borders);
127             else
128               {
129                 difference_type chunk_length =
130                     ((double)n
131                      / ((double)num_threads + __s.partial_sum_dilation)),
132                   borderstart = n - num_threads * chunk_length;
133                 borders[0] = 0;
134                 for (int i = 1; i < (num_threads + 1); ++i)
135                   {
136                     borders[i] = borderstart;
137                     borderstart += chunk_length;
138                   }
139                 borders[num_threads + 1] = n;
140               }
141
142             sums = static_cast<value_type*>(::operator new(sizeof(value_type)
143                                                            * num_threads));
144             OutputIterator target_end;
145           } //single
146
147         thread_index_t iam = omp_get_thread_num();
148         if (iam == 0)
149           {
150             *result = *begin;
151             parallel_partial_sum_basecase(begin + 1, begin + borders[1],
152                                           result + 1, bin_op, *begin);
153             ::new(&(sums[iam])) value_type(*(result + borders[1] - 1));
154           }
155         else
156           {
157             ::new(&(sums[iam]))
158               value_type(__gnu_parallel::accumulate(begin + borders[iam] + 1,
159                                          begin + borders[iam + 1],
160                                          *(begin + borders[iam]),
161                                          bin_op,
162                                          __gnu_parallel::sequential_tag()));
163           }
164
165 #       pragma omp barrier
166
167 #       pragma omp single
168           parallel_partial_sum_basecase(
169               sums + 1, sums + num_threads, sums + 1, bin_op, sums[0]);
170
171 #       pragma omp barrier
172
173         // Still same team.
174         parallel_partial_sum_basecase(begin + borders[iam + 1],
175                                       begin + borders[iam + 2],
176                                       result + borders[iam + 1], bin_op,
177                                       sums[iam]);
178       } //parallel
179
180     ::operator delete(sums);
181     delete[] borders;
182
183     return result + n;
184   }
185
186 /** @brief Parallel partial sum front-end.
187   *  @param begin Begin iterator of input sequence.
188   *  @param end End iterator of input sequence.
189   *  @param result Begin iterator of output sequence.
190   *  @param bin_op Associative binary function.
191   *  @return End iterator of output sequence. */
192 template<typename InputIterator,
193          typename OutputIterator,
194          typename BinaryOperation>
195   OutputIterator
196   parallel_partial_sum(InputIterator begin, InputIterator end,
197                        OutputIterator result, BinaryOperation bin_op)
198   {
199     _GLIBCXX_CALL(begin - end)
200
201     typedef std::iterator_traits<InputIterator> traits_type;
202     typedef typename traits_type::value_type value_type;
203     typedef typename traits_type::difference_type difference_type;
204
205     difference_type n = end - begin;
206
207     switch (_Settings::get().partial_sum_algorithm)
208       {
209       case LINEAR:
210         // Need an initial offset.
211         return parallel_partial_sum_linear(begin, end, result, bin_op, n);
212       default:
213     // Partial_sum algorithm not implemented.
214         _GLIBCXX_PARALLEL_ASSERT(0);
215         return result + n;
216       }
217   }
218 }
